Understanding Electrostatic Precipitators

An electrostatic precipitator, usually known as an ESP, is undoubtedly an air filtration system that gets rid of fine particles, like dust and smoke, from the flowing gasoline utilizing the force of the induced electrostatic charge. This engineering is a staple in industrial pollution methods and is particularly helpful in capturing airborne particles from textile manufacturing procedures. the look and performance of an ESP allow it to be an excellent choice for minimizing emissions in industries wherever air high-quality is a concern, for instance textile production. In textile production, ESPs serve as a vital component in managing emissions. One of the myriad pollutants produced through textile manufacturing, Kleanland's ESP proficiently seize organic oils, dyes, and fiber particles, which happen to be popular by-goods of the process. By purifying the air, ESPs contribute to your cleaner generation ecosystem and support textile companies adhere to stringent environmental rules. These programs are not only productive but also adaptable, capable of becoming customized to fulfill certain requirements of different textile processing models. The job of ESPs in Textile output

Textile generation includes a number of stages, each contributing to your emission of various pollutants. From spinning and weaving to dyeing and ending, Each and every phase provides one of a kind worries in retaining air high quality. Electrostatic precipitators supply an extensive Option by capturing pollutants at different factors from the creation method. Their ability to concentrate on certain emissions would make ESPs indispensable in textile producing. considered one of the key benefits of working with Klean-ESP know-how in textile manufacturing is its efficiency in eliminating particulate issue from exhaust gases. The textile marketplace generates a considerable level of oil-bearing fumes and other pollutants, which might adversely have an effect on each the atmosphere and human wellness. Kleanland's ESP deal with this issue by capturing as much as ninety nine% of these pollutants, therefore considerably lowering the environmental footprint of textile output.
